We can't actually confirm that 100% from what's in Spotlight Galvatron I'm afraid Hotrod. I'd certainly agree that Galvatron's narration is very suggestive that this was the case and it's my own personal favourite theory at the moment but the last mention that the Golden Age Prime gets by name is "Prime felt it first, a resonant tug from somewhere deep within the Matrix he carried. It was he ddescribed like a door opening. A door to somewhere else, and within absolute power." against the images of the Ark 1's ill fated mission to the Benzuli Expanse. Any further comments regarding Galvatron's master are phrased as 'he' rather than 'Prime'. I'd say that it's implied that the 'he' in question is the same Prime but for the sake of suspense, along with the lack of any art for that Prime that would confirm this and ruin some surprises in upcoming books, is quite deliberately being left unconfirmed as the pieces of the Dead Universe story arc fall into place.
We'll see more in the Prime book but this is probably going to drag out for over a year. Bear in mind that after Devastation the next main arc is entitled Revelation. That's where my money's on us getting some definative answers to the whole Matrix/Nemesis/Galvatron triangle.
